Handover Note — Divestiture of the Ferrow Logistics Unit

From: D. Marchetti, outgoing director
To: S. Oyelaran, incoming director
Cc: Heads of Department

Sale of Ferrow Logistics to Calverton Group is at signing stage. Diligence closed; two warranties outstanding. Staff consultation begins Monday. Keep communications minimal until announcement. Full context is in the confidential note that follows.

board note of fafog-yahap: Project Rusdor slips by a full year because of the audit delay.

Handing ChipScan reader duties to the plugin crowd. Readers poll mats every 200ms; dedupe window is enforced server-side, don't reimplement it. Plugins must emit splits in monotonic order or the collator drops them silently. Test against the Hollow Creek replay fixtures before publishing. Current collator settings your plugin will run against are listed below.

config for kafof-bawef:
holath:
  log_level: debug
  metrics_host: metrics.holath.qorvelsys.internal
  pin: 2191
  pool_size: 32

The Rovano dispatch service can't read its heuristic weights because the Cobblevault instance sealed itself after three failed token renewals last night. Assignments are currently falling back to nearest-driver only, which ignores shift balance and ratings. Reviewer: please check the attached diff that adds a cached-weights fallback so a sealed vault doesn't degrade routing this badly again. To unseal Cobblevault and restore the live weights, use the recovery passphrase listed below.

strongbox words: prawyn-fenmir